2

我想开发 Office 2010/2013 插件。我有未连接到 Internet 的 Win 7 x64 机器,因此我下载了 Office 开发所需的所有设置,并尝试按照此处的说明将它们安装在机器上。

我在这台机器上安装了 Office 2010。

我有以下困难。

  • 在安装 MicrosoftIdentityExtensions-64.msi 时,它说它需要“Microsoft Identity Foundation”。所以我明确下载并安装了Windows6.1-KB974405-x64.msu
  • 在安装 WorkflowManagerTools_x64.msi 时,它说它需要 Microsoft Visual Studio 2012,尽管我已经安装了 VS Express 2012 for Desktop。它需要完整的VS吗?不是在 VS Express 上完成的吗?所以我绝对无法安装这个 WorkflowManagerTools_x64.msi

在此处输入图像描述

  • 此外,在安装 officetools_bundle.exe 时,安装程​​序说它需要用于 Visual Studio 2012 的 Visual Studio Web 开发人员工具,尽管它允许继续安装。

在安装了链接中所述的所有其他设置并出现上述问题后,我仍然没有在 VS 的新项目窗口中获得 Office Add In 模板

  • 我是否可以在 Win 7 x64 机器上使用 VS Express 2012 for Desktop 开发 Office 2013 插件,或者 Office 2010 的插件可以在 Office 2013 上正常工作。
  • 我需要完整的 VS 2012 来进行 Office 开发吗?

具体来说,我想开发一些 Outlook 插件。

4

1 回答 1

0

对于 Office 插件开发,您需要 Visual Studio Professional 或更高版本。VS Express 版本不支持 VSTO。

于 2015-08-07T10:20:44.717 回答